Solution 01
A²OS+SDW
Reconstructing R&D, Accelerating Innovation. Confronting the Challenges of E/E Architecture Evolution, Empowering OEM to Master the AI-Defined Vehicle Era.
Key Features
-
Resilient Architecture: Develop Once, Reuse ContinuouslyA²OS builds a unified, scalable intelligent digital base, achieving deep decoupling of software and hardware. Regardless of how the E/E architecture evolves, core functionalities and middleware can be seamlessly migrated and reused. This allows R&D resources to focus on truly value-creating aspects.
-
Agile Response: Rapid Adaptation, Seizing OpportunitiesSDW provides a visual, low-code agile development platform covering the entire process from requirement analysis, design, development to testing. It compresses the delivery cycle for new features and scenarios from "months" to "weeks" or even "days". This helps OEM respond to market change requests and user demands at an accelerated pace, quickly validate and deliver differentiated features, and win the market.
Core Technologies
-
Agent OS
A Cross-Platform Automotive Agent OS with Flexible LLM Selection.
Empowering automotive Agent development with a low-code,feature-rich SDK, and framework for rapid iteration and deployment. -
AI ToolChain
Covers the entire lifecycle of in-vehicle applications with an AI toolchain encompassing requirements analysis, software design, engineering configuration, code generation, testing, and debugging. This results to forming a closed-loop ecosystem.
-
VehicleBus
Utilises DDS/TSN/SOME/IP to establish SOA communication, enabling cross-domain communication with high concurrency and low latency (ASIL-B).
-
Automotive Middleware
Self-developed AP and CP, offering a complete SOA solution, providing robust security mechanisms, with core components certified to ISO 26262.
-
UEA
UE is a customisable lightweight engine tailored for AUTOMOTIVE, serving as the cornerstone for rapid 3D HMI application development.

Solution 02
A²OS Powering Automotive Intelligence
KOTEI's A²OS addresses the comprehensive needs of smart vehicles by integrating an AI foundation, resource sharing & isolation, data sharing, computing power expansion, functional safety, cyber security, and real-time reliable communication. By fully leveraging the edge-side understanding brain and cloud-side generative brain, A²OS empowers the evolution of automotive intelligence.
Key Features
-
AI CockpitEnhanced Visual Perception: Achieves higher precision in face, emotion, and gesture recognition, balancing passenger emotional engagement with enhanced driving safety.
Evolved Voice Interaction: Advances from “Voice assistant” to “Voice AI agent”, supporting natural dialogue and comprehension of complex contexts.
Generative HMI Display: Leverages cloud-based generative AI to dynamically produce personalized interface content, including text, voice, and images.
Multimodal Fusion Perception: Integrates human, vehicle, and environmental data to improve overall travel efficiency and safety.
-
ADAS/ADEnhanced Perception and Localized Decision-Making: Multimodal large model perception fusion — VLM uniformly analyzes camera, radar, and LiDAR data to enhance scene interpretation; integrated prediction and planning — based on driving foundation models, achieving more human-like, safer, and smoother trajectory planning.
Drives the evolution of autonomous driving from traditional "perception + rule-based" algorithmic architectures towards a data-driven, continuously learning End-to-End AI Agent (E-E AI Agent).
